About Edi Prifti
Edi Prifti is a scholar working on Molecular Biology, Physiology, Epidemiology, Cardiology and Cardiovascular Medicine and Plant Science, having authored 44 papers that have together received 3.0k indexed citations. Recurring topics across this work include Gut microbiota and health (16 papers), Diet and metabolism studies (6 papers), Genomics and Phylogenetic Studies (5 papers), Metabolomics and Mass Spectrometry Studies (4 papers), Adipokines, Inflammation, and Metabolic Diseases (4 papers), Smart Agriculture and AI (3 papers), Gene expression and cancer classification (2 papers) and Nutritional Studies and Diet (2 papers). The work is most often cited by research in Physiology (1.1k citations), Biological Psychiatry (92 citations), Molecular Biology (2.0k citations), Gastroenterology (119 citations) and Nutrition and Dietetics (238 citations). Edi Prifti has collaborated with scholars based in France, United States and United Kingdom. Frequent co-authors include Karine Clément, Brandon D. Kayser, Joël Doré, Judith Aron‐Wisnewsky, Patrice D. Cani, Eric O. Verger, Florence Levenez, Salwa W. Rizkalla, Amandine Everard and Nataliya Sokolovska. Their work appears in journals such as Scientific Reports, Bioinformatics, ZooKeys, Microbial Genomics and American Journal of Physiology-Endocrinology and Metabolism.
